How they compare

Ghana currently reports 7 1000 USD against 2 1000 USD in Djibouti, a difference of 5 1000 USD.

That makes Ghana's figure about 3.5 times Djibouti's.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 16 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Ghana ahead.

Djibouti ranks 40th and Ghana ranks 37th of 158 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Djibouti averaged higher in 1 and Ghana in 2.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
